TempoTunes has 632 songs with a verified tempo of 179 BPM, led by punk, metal, drum-and-bass. Here are some of the best-known tracks at this pace.
179 BPM is fast: punk, metal, footwork, and sprint-interval fuel. 179 BPM also lines up with a running cadence of about 179 steps per minute, a quick turnover that suits speedwork. Plenty of half-time songs land here too, feeling like 90 BPM.
